Yes, I have on occasion connected drives using a converter to connect
old USB to USB-C, that doesn't make a tight connection, and with a
little wiggle it disconnects. Good cables matter.
In this case I'm using those nice thick cables that came with the little
portable WD drives I am using, short USB-C to USB-C, including using the
converters that came with them to plug into an old type USB jack on the
powered hub. To the connect to the Pi I use a longer, also heavy cable
that I think came with the hub.
This hardware worked on my laptop, worked on PI 4 with slow USB, and
currently works great on Pi 4 with Linux SW raid 1.
